Key Replacement

There are various types of keys for 2012 mazda 3 key fob vehicles. Some require programming, while others do not. The year of your car and the type of key (fobs remotes, fobs, chips, "push to start" keys and so on.) will determine whether or not you have to program your key. Only a dealer or an automotive locksmith is equipped with the specific equipment required to program keys. Metal keys that do not have transponders do not require programming.

To avoid losing your keys keep them in a secure area where children are not able to access. Keep an exact record of the number on the plate that comes to the key set. Do not keep it in your vehicle. This code number will be handy in the event that you need to purchase a new key or reprogramme your current one.

Key Fob Battery Replacement

Replace the battery if the key fob isn't working anymore or if its buttons aren't working as well. Car key fob batteries can wear out as quickly as three to four years depending on how often you use your vehicle. The battery will be visible on your dashboard, and you must check it frequently.

You can do it yourself. However, you'll require an incredibly small screwdriver as well as a new battery. You'll need to ensure you don't damage the rubber ring the old battery rests on. It's best to replace this before installing the new battery.

With your screwdriver, break off the two seams on the case. It's probably easier to simply place your screwdriver into a few spots around the perimeter of the case and then gently pry. You may need to do this a few times before the case is completely open.

Then, insert your new battery into the slot, making sure the positive (+) side is facing upwards. It is possible that you will need to press firmly on both sides of the case to secure it shut. When the case is shut then put the ring made of metal back in place and test the key fob to confirm that the buttons are functioning.
